“Oryx and Crake” is a speculative fiction novel by Margaret Atwood, the first book in her MaddAddam trilogy. Set in a dystopian future, the story is narrated by Snowman, also known as Jimmy, who appears to be the last human survivor of a catastrophic event.

The novel explores a world that has been ravaged by genetic engineering, corporate greed, and environmental degradation. Through Snowman’s memories, the reader learns about his childhood friendship with Crake, a brilliant but morally ambiguous scientist, and his infatuation with Oryx, a mysterious woman who becomes intertwined with their lives.

As the narrative unfolds, Atwood reveals the disturbing truths behind the creation of this society and the catastrophic consequences of unchecked scientific experimentation. The novel raises profound questions about the ethical implications of biotechnology, the nature of humanity, and the fragility of the natural world.

“Oryx and Crake” is a thought-provoking and deeply unsettling exploration of the potential consequences of technological advancement and human folly. Atwood’s masterful storytelling and vivid imagination make it a compelling and unforgettable read.
